About

Founded in January 2012 in France, the Union of Medical Care and Relief Organizations (UOSSM) is a coalition of humanitarian, non-governmental, and medical organizations from the United States, Canada, United Kingdom, France, Germany, Netherlands, Switzerland, and Turkey. Member organizations pool their resources and coordinate joint projects to provide independent and impartial relief and medical care to victims of war in Syria. UOSSM chapters work under a unified strategic framework to increase the effectiveness of the humanitarian response in areas of crisis.

UOSSM provides humanitarian and medical assistance to all Syrian victims of war regardless of their religion, ethnicity, or political affiliation.

UOSSM France is entering a turning point in its history. After 11 years of humanitarian and medical commitment in Syria, UOSSM France is undergoing a transformation by changing its name and visual identity. Staying focused on its vision and missions, it chooses the independence of its action and governance to coordinate and implement its health programs. To better respond to the needs of populations in a sustainable manner and include health issues in a broader vision of development, our NGO becomes Mehad.
